The No. 20 SMU Mustangs (0-0) are set to face the Florida State Seminoles (1-0) on Monday night at Doak Campbell Stadium in Tallahassee, Florida. The kickoff is scheduled for 7:30 p.m. ET with coverage provided by ESPN. This matchup marks a significant ACC conference contest as SMU looks to establish itself among the top contenders for an FBS playoff spot.
Betting Lines and Market Analysis
According to lines last updated Sunday at 9:34 p.m. ET via FanDuel Sportsbook, the Mustangs are listed as slight favorites on the moneyline at -152. This means a bettor would need to wager $152 to win $100. Conversely, Florida State is available at +126, offering a return of $126 for every $100 wagered. Against the spread (ATS), SMU opens as favorites by 2.5 points (-122), while FSU offers even money (+100) to cover that same margin.
The Over/Under line is set at 53.5 points, with the Under priced at -115 and the Over at -105. These odds reflect a competitive expectation between two programs entering or continuing their seasons under high scrutiny in college football rankings such as the LBM Coaches Poll.
Team Performance Context
The historical context for this rivalry favors SMU, who leads the all-time series 1-0 after defeating Florida State 42-16 on Sept. 28, 2024, in Dallas during their first battle as ACC rivals. That previous contest saw the Mustangs cover a 6.5-point spread and see the Over (46.5) cash, as we reported in SMU vs. Florida State Football Preview.
For SMU, quarterback Kevin Jennings carries immense preseason expectations after producing 59 touchdowns across the past two seasons. He has reliable targets in wide receivers Jalen Cooper and Yamir Knight. The Seminoles, however, have already played one game, suffering a sluggish performance in their Week 0 win over New Mexico State (34-17). FSU failed to cover as 31.5-point favorites, with the Under hanging on despite late scoring, a story we covered in Florida State Football Faces Early Tests Before SMU Clash.
Expert Predictions and Key Players
Betting analysis suggests that laying the small amount of points for SMU (-2.5) is a smarter play than taking the moneyline favorite. The prediction model forecasts an SMU victory 27-20, citing a superior quarterback performance and a suffocating defense capable of troubling FSU QB Ashton Daniels, according to Fox News.
Daniels threw for 202 yards with one touchdown and one interception against New Mexico State, relying heavily on running back Ousmane Kromah, who rushed for 115 yards. Wide receiver Duce Robinson also struggled to find the end zone in that opener. Analysts project Jennings will exploit open spaces against a Florida State passing defense that allowed 272 passing yards last weekend.
